
Deepinder Goyal, is an IIT Delhi alumnus, and co-founder of Zomato along with Pankaj Chaddah. He always envisioned being an entrepreneur but his entry into the food industry was inadvertent. It grew when he worked at Bain and Company as a management consultant.

Indian business magnate, Sachin Bansal, is a multi-millionaire and a proud founder of Flipkart. Sachin Bansal and Binny Bansal’s Flipkart achieved great milestones in its 11 year journey. The company started as an online bookstore, and underwent a gradual yet steady expansion to become one of the most valuable startups in India.

Neeraj Arora, IIT Delhi’s notable alumni is the mainstay behind the popular networking app, WhatsApp. Initially working with coveted tech giant Google where he gained expertise in strategic investments, he later went on to work with WhatsApp. One of the earliest employees of the company, he has helped build WhatsApp’s foundation in the Indian market.

Rajat Khare studied in IIT Delhi in B.Tech (Computer Science) is the founder of Boundary Holding- a bridge fund in Luxembourg which invests in next-gen tech startups like AI, Machine Learning, Big Dat etc. He had earlier founded an educational startup.

Vikrant Bhargava is an Indian origin British entrepreneur and is alumnus of Indian Institute of Management Calcutta and Indian Institute of Technology Delhi. Bhargava joined Partygaming in 2000 and was responsible for the marketing operations of the launch of PartyPoker.

An IIT Delhi alumni and IIM Bangalore gold medalist, Puneet Dalmia is the Managing Director of Dalmia Bharat Group. Being the mastermind behind the exponential rise of the Indian cement company, he took over the operations in 2007 and registered a sales revenue growth of more than Rs 10,000 crore.
